Yesterday was an important day for our village. Our students learned about the Métis jig, pow wow dancing and smudging. As a whole school we danced a round dance that held special significance for us on one of our last days together as a school. Together we celebrated National Indigenous Peoples Day and we danced a few last dances together. A school that dances together makes memories together. Watch for our video still to come.
